In this episode, Christian and Dominic Tiroch meet at our workshop to take the first big step in terms of design implementation in the interior.

The roll cage as well as the Bride bucket seats had already been installed in the interior. The green 6-point Takata safety harness round off the racer feel. To put the finishing touches on the interior the duo has planned a number of things. The first step consists of re-installing the original plastics. DOTZ DD2.JZ Innenraum In order to carry out these works Christian and Dominic not only de-install the Bride seats, even the roll cage must be removed again almost entirely. DOTZ DD2.JZ BMW Z4 InnenraumThe required deinstallation of the roll cage that fits down to the millimeter asks a lot of patience of the duo. DD2.JZ InnenraumausbauAfter the safety cell is finally dismantled, Dominic and Christian start to install the liner as well as the standard plastics. Innenraumausbau DOTZ DD2.JZ BMW Z4The interior of our DD2.JZ looks quite presentable already with the built-in interior trim and the makeshift attached roof liner. Christian and Dominic finally discuss the next steps to complete the interior and plan the remaining design features which will turn our DD2.JZ into a breath-taking show car. 2JZ Engine BMW Z4 DD2.JZ
